Ingrid Zabel

Dr. Ingrid Zabel works on making climate change science accessible to the public at the Paleontological Research Institution in Ithaca, NY via exhibits at the Museum of the Earth and the Cayuga Nature Center, teacher resources, and education programs for youth and adults. Her research background includes condensed matter physics, geophysics, remote sensing, and radar systems.
